Petals Fall

Petals fall.
Moving to a consuming music only they can hear.
Dancing in unison with their shadows on the earth below.
They will meet soon.
No longer to tease one another with suggestive pirouettes or evocative swirls.
They will embrace, predestined partners never alone again.
So is their fortunate life.
Envied by all.
